The Staff of the Idaho Public Utilities requests that Avista Corporation (Company;
Avista) provide the following documents and information as soon as possible, by THURSDAY
JANUARY 2,2014.
This Production Request is to be considered as continuing, and Avista is requested to
provide, by way of supplementary responses, additional documents that it or any person acting
on its behalf may later obtain that will augment the documents produced.
Please provide answers to each question, including supporting workpapers that provide
detail or are the source of information used in calculations. The Company is reminded that
responses pursuant to Commission Rules of Procedure must include the name and phone number
of the person preparing the document, and the name, location and phone number of the record
holder and if different the witness who can sponsor the answer at hearing if need be. Reference
IDAPA 31.01.01.228.

REQUEST NO. 1: Please list all expenses charged to the Idaho DSM Rider ("Rider")
for the years 2010-2012. Please include date, vendor, amount, and a brief description of the
expense. Please separate expenses by year and by program. If any expenses were allocated to
Idaho, please provide the total system expense and the method of allocating Idaho's share.
REQUEST NO. 2: Please provide the Rider revenue by year and by class for the years
2010-20t2.
REQUEST NO.3: Please provide the calculation of any carrying charge on the Rider
balance for the years 2010-2012.
REQUEST NO. 4: Please provide a list of all external consulting and evaluation fees
paid from the rider during 2010-2012. Please indicate how any of those expenses were allocated
between j urisdictions.
REQUEST NO. 5: Please provide a justification of funding for the Northwest Energy
Efficiency Alliance ("NEEA"). Please include all savings attributed to Avista's Idaho
jurisdiction from NEEA for each year (2010-2012), along with amounts paid to NEEA as a part
of the current cycle funding agreement. Please report the savings for each year: 1) based on
funding allocation, and2) based on sales data for Avista's Idaho service territory.
REQUEST NO. 6: Please provide an electronic copy and three hard copies of Avista's
Technical Reference Manual.
REQUEST NO. 7: Please provide the Requests for Proposals ("RFPs") for all
evaluation services between 2010 and 2012 and all responses to those RFPs. Also, please
provide the number, location, and duration of all RFP advertisements.

REQUEST NO. 8: Page l0 of Ms. Hermanson's testimony says Cadmus was retained
for another two years in part to provide a "deeper evaluation for the 2012 and 2013 program
years." Please explain in detail the deep evaluation services Cadmus provided in the contract
extension that could not have been provided by another evaluator.
REQUEST NO. 9: Page l0 of Ms. Hermanson's testimony says Cadmus was retained
for another two years in part to conduct "some market analysis for the 2012 and 2013 electric
and gas DSM portfolio." Please explain market analysis, how it is differs from a Conservation
Potential Assessment, and why it is necessary for gas DSM in Idaho which was suspended in
20t2.
REQUEST NO. 10: Besides health and safety measures, what other non-energy benefits
("NEBs") were included in the low income cost-effectiveness calculation?
REQUEST NO. 11: Page 9 of the Avista 2012ldaho Electric Impact evaluation
recommends that Avista o'consider analyzing easy to quantiff NEBs, which could be added to the
programs for cost-effectiveness reporting." Please explain which NEBs are being referenced and
how they might be analyzed.

REQUEST NO. 15: Please explain why Avista used 2009 Cadmus evaluation data for
clothes washer energy savings estimates rather than then-current Regional Technical Forum
("RTF") data.
REQUEST NO. 16: Please list the projects, incentive payments, and locations for all
Office of Energy Resources ("OER") projects that Avista incented in20l0,20ll, and20l2.
REQUEST NO. 17: Please provide the percentage of residential, commercial, and
industrial customers who participated in Avista's DSM programs in 2010, 2011, and20l2.
REQUEST NO. 18: Please explain why Avista does not track the Residential New
Construction program separately from the Residential Home Improvement program.
REQUEST NO. 19: Please provide Avista's cost-effectiveness calculations, including
all input and assumptions in executable Excel format, for the TRCruCT Simple Steps Smart
Savings program in 2012 (17 .04) and 20 1 I ( I .95).
